Parking

Emeriti faculty from the Medford/Somerville campus may request a parking permit without charge from the Office of the Provost to use when parking on the Medford/Somerville campus. Shortly after your emeriti status is conferred, the Office of the Vice Provost for Faculty will reach out to you to gather license plate information. We are only able to provide a parking permit for one vehicle per emeriti faculty and the permit is non-transferrable. If you have any questions, please contact faculty@tufts.edu for more information. If your license plate number changes, please contact faculty@tufts.edu to update it. 

Emeriti faculty from the Grafton campus may apply to Public Safety on the Grafton Campus for a parking permit, and the fee will be waived. Please note that your parking permit is for your use only and cannot be transferred to any other individual.  

Complementary parking privileges are not available on the Boston and SMFA campuses at this time.

Library 

Emeriti faculty may use their Tufts ID cards to access Tufts Library Systems as well as attend other events and activities on campus.  This includes automatic access to the Hirsh Health Sciences Library on the Boston campus, the Webster Family Library of Veterinary Medicine on the Grafton campus, the Edwin Ginn Library at the Fletcher School on the Medford/Somerville campus and the Tisch Library on the Medford/Somerville Campus, including access to online resources.   

AS&E emeriti faculty may request carrel space in Tisch Library on the Medford/Somerville campus, to be assigned when available. For more information, please visit the Tisch Library website or contact the Tisch Library circulation desk at (617) 627-3347.
